The programmable robots market has experienced significant growth in recent years, driven by advancements in robotics technology and the increasing demand for automation across various industries. Programmable robots, also known as autonomous robots, are designed to perform specific tasks or functions with minimal human intervention. These robots can be programmed to execute complex tasks, navigate through environments, and interact with objects and humans.

The global programmable robots market size was USD 3.29 Billion in 2022 and is expected to register a steady revenue CAGR of 16.4% during the forecast period, according to latest analysis by Emergen Research. One of the key drivers of the programmable robots market is the need for increased efficiency and productivity in industries such as manufacturing, logistics, and healthcare. Programmable robots can perform repetitive tasks with precision and accuracy, reducing the risk of errors and improving overall operational efficiency. These robots can work continuously without fatigue, leading to increased productivity and cost savings for businesses.

Another driver of the market is the growing focus on safety and risk mitigation. Programmable robots can be deployed in hazardous environments or perform tasks that are dangerous for humans. By replacing human workers in such environments, programmable robots can help prevent accidents and injuries, ensuring a safer work environment. This has led to increased adoption of programmable robots in industries such as mining, oil and gas, and construction.

However, the programmable robots market also faces certain restraints. One of the major challenges is the high initial cost of investment. Programmable robots are sophisticated machines that require significant capital investment for research and development, manufacturing, and deployment. The cost of sensors, actuators, and other components adds to the overall cost of these robots. This can limit the adoption of programmable robots, especially for small and medium-sized enterprises with budget constraints.

Furthermore, the complexity of programming and customization can be a restraint to the market. While programmable robots offer flexibility and versatility, programming them to perform specific tasks requires specialized skills and expertise. This can be a barrier for businesses that do not have the necessary technical knowledge or resources to program and customize these robots. Simplifying the programming process and providing user-friendly interfaces can help overcome this challenge and drive wider adoption of programmable robots.
